Q: Is 2,823,888 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,823,888 is a composite number.

Why is 2,823,888 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,823,888 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 16 24 48 58,831 117,662 176,493 235,324 352,986 470,648 705,972 941,296 1,411,944 and 2,823,888, with no remainder.

Since 2,823,888 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,823,888, it is a composite number.
